Understanding the G-Shot Procedure
The G-Shot, a non-surgical enhancement procedure for the G-spot, has gained popularity for its potential to enhance sexual pleasure. This procedure involves the injection of a hyaluronic acid-based filler directly into the G-spot area, which can temporarily increase its size and sensitivity.
Preparation for the G-Shot
Before undergoing the G-Shot, it's essential to have a thorough consultation with a qualified medical professional. This consultation will include a discussion about your medical history, current health status, and expectations from the procedure. Additionally, you will receive detailed instructions on how to prepare for the day of the procedure, which may include avoiding certain medications and maintaining good hygiene.
The Procedure Itself
The G-Shot procedure typically takes about 10 to 15 minutes to complete. It is performed using local anesthesia to ensure your comfort throughout the process. The doctor will use a speculum to visualize the G-spot and then inject the filler material. The injection is relatively quick, and most patients report minimal discomfort during and after the procedure.
Recovery and Results
Immediately following the G-Shot, you may experience some mild discomfort, swelling, or bruising in the treated area. These symptoms are usually temporary and can be managed with over-the-counter pain relievers and cold compresses. It's important to avoid sexual activity for at least 48 hours post-procedure to allow the area to heal properly.
The results of the G-Shot can be noticeable almost immediately, with the full effects becoming apparent within a week. The enhancement typically lasts between 4 to 6 months, after which a follow-up treatment may be necessary to maintain the desired results.

Understanding the G-Shot Procedure
The G-Shot, a non-surgical enhancement procedure, aims to increase the size and sensitivity of the G-spot. This treatment involves injecting a dermal filler into the area to provide a more pronounced and responsive G-spot. The procedure is relatively straightforward and typically takes about 15 minutes to complete.
Pre-Procedure Consultation
Before undergoing the G-Shot, it's crucial to have a thorough consultation with a qualified medical professional. During this consultation, the doctor will discuss your medical history, expectations, and any potential risks or side effects. This step ensures that you are a suitable candidate for the procedure and that you have realistic expectations about the outcomes.
The Procedure Itself
On the day of the procedure, the area will be numbed to ensure comfort. The doctor will then use a speculum to locate the G-spot and inject the dermal filler. The entire process is quick, usually taking no more than 15 minutes. Patients can expect some mild discomfort during the injection, but this is generally well-tolerated.
Post-Procedure Recovery
After the G-Shot, patients may experience some mild swelling, bruising, or discomfort in the treated area. These symptoms are normal and typically resolve within a few days. It's important to follow any post-procedure care instructions provided by your doctor to ensure optimal recovery and results.
Expected Results and Longevity
The results of the G-Shot can be noticeable immediately after the procedure. Patients often report increased sensitivity and a more pronounced G-spot. The effects of the G-Shot can last between four months to a year, depending on the individual and the type of filler used. Regular follow-up appointments may be necessary to maintain the desired results.
